Abstract :
A personalized system considering user context and social histories is attractive. We present a personalized transportation system called PATRASH: Personalized Autonomous Transportation recommendation System considering user context and History. PATRASH considers not only users´ context and transportation histories, but also real bus delay. The bus delay returned by Bus Delay API (BDAPI) is used for making adjustments of recommended routes. In this paper, we proposes a model for dealing with the bus delay information. We also make confirmation of effectiveness or possibilities of personalized route recommendation based on user context and histories. To this end, we investigated 10 examinees´ usage histories of public transportation as a preliminal case study. The preliminal investigation results promise us to predict individual public transportation route.
